# Cross-Channel Command Centralization Implementation Plan
|
||||||
|
|
||||||
|
> **For Claude:** REQUIRED SUB-SKILL: Use superpowers:executing-plans to implement this plan task-by-task.
|
||||||
|
|
||||||
|
**Goal:** Centralize generic command parsing/policy/execution in `pkg/commands`, remove duplicated command business logic from `AgentLoop` and channel adapters, and enforce consistent cross-channel behavior.
|
||||||
|
|
||||||
|
**Architecture:** Add a tri-state command executor (`handled` / `rejected` / `passthrough`) in `pkg/commands` and make `AgentLoop.processMessage` call it before LLM flow. Command handlers receive minimal runtime capabilities from agent (session operations, scope key, config, channel). Channels stop local business command execution and only forward inbound messages + platform command registration metadata.
|
||||||
|
|
||||||
|
**Tech Stack:** Go, existing `pkg/commands`, `pkg/agent`, `pkg/channels/*`, table-driven tests with `go test`.

### Task 1: Add Executor Tri-State Contract in `pkg/commands`
|
||||||
|
|
||||||
|
**Files:**
|
||||||
|
- Create: `pkg/commands/executor.go`
|
||||||
|
- Test: `pkg/commands/executor_test.go`
|
||||||
|
- Modify: `pkg/commands/definition.go`
|
||||||
|
|
||||||
|
**Step 1: Write the failing test**
|
||||||
|
|
||||||
|
```go
|
||||||
|
func TestExecutor_RegisteredButUnsupported_ReturnsRejected(t *testing.T) {
|
||||||
|
defs := []Definition{{Name: "show", Channels: []string{"telegram"}}}
|
||||||
|
ex := NewExecutor(NewRegistry(defs))
|
||||||
|
|
||||||
|
res := ex.Execute(context.Background(), Request{Channel: "whatsapp", Text: "/show"}, nil)
|
||||||
|
if res.Outcome != OutcomeRejected {
|
||||||
|
t.Fatalf("outcome=%v", res.Outcome)
|
||||||
|
}
|
||||||
|
}
|
||||||
|
```
|
||||||
|
|
||||||
|
**Step 2: Run test to verify it fails**
|
||||||
|
|
||||||
|
Run: `go test ./pkg/commands -run TestExecutor_RegisteredButUnsupported_ReturnsRejected -v`
|
||||||
|
Expected: FAIL with undefined `NewExecutor/OutcomeRejected`.
|
||||||
|
|
||||||
|
**Step 3: Write minimal implementation**
|
||||||
|
|
||||||
|
```go
|
||||||
|
type Outcome int
|
||||||
|
|
||||||
|
const (
|
||||||
|
OutcomePassthrough Outcome = iota
|
||||||
|
OutcomeHandled
|
||||||
|
OutcomeRejected
|
||||||
|
)
|
||||||
|
|
||||||
|
type ExecuteResult struct {
|
||||||
|
Outcome Outcome
|
||||||
|
Command string
|
||||||
|
Reply string
|
||||||
|
Err error
|
||||||
|
}
|
||||||
|
|
||||||
|
type Executor struct { reg *Registry }
|
||||||
|
```
|
||||||
|
|
||||||
|
Implement `Execute(...)` to:
|
||||||
|
- parse slash command token,
|
||||||
|
- detect `registered+unsupported => rejected`,
|
||||||
|
- detect `unknown => passthrough`,
|
||||||
|
- keep `handled` path for supported commands with handlers.
|
||||||
|
|
||||||
|
**Step 4: Run test to verify it passes**
|
||||||
|
|
||||||
|
Run: `go test ./pkg/commands -run TestExecutor_RegisteredButUnsupported_ReturnsRejected -v`
|
||||||
|
Expected: PASS.
|
||||||
|
|
||||||
|
**Step 5: Commit**
|
||||||
|
|
||||||
|
```bash
|
||||||
|
git add pkg/commands/executor.go pkg/commands/executor_test.go pkg/commands/definition.go
|
||||||
|
git commit -m "feat(commands): add tri-state command executor contract"
|
||||||
|
```

### Task 2: Define Command Runtime Interfaces for Agent-Backed Handlers
|
||||||
|
|
||||||
|
**Files:**
|
||||||
|
- Create: `pkg/commands/runtime.go`
|
||||||
|
- Test: `pkg/commands/runtime_test.go`
|
||||||
|
|
||||||
|
**Step 1: Write the failing test**
|
||||||
|
|
||||||
|
```go
|
||||||
|
func TestRuntimeContracts_MinimalSessionOps(t *testing.T) {
|
||||||
|
var _ SessionOps = (*fakeSessionOps)(nil)
|
||||||
|
var _ Runtime = (*fakeRuntime)(nil)
|
||||||
|
}
|
||||||
|
```
|
||||||
|
|
||||||
|
**Step 2: Run test to verify it fails**
|
||||||
|
|
||||||
|
Run: `go test ./pkg/commands -run TestRuntimeContracts_MinimalSessionOps -v`
|
||||||
|
Expected: FAIL with undefined interfaces.
|
||||||
|
|
||||||
|
**Step 3: Write minimal implementation**
|
||||||
|
|
||||||
|
```go
|
||||||
|
type SessionOps interface {
|
||||||
|
ResolveActive(scopeKey string) (string, error)
|
||||||
|
StartNew(scopeKey string) (string, error)
|
||||||
|
List(scopeKey string) ([]session.SessionMeta, error)
|
||||||
|
Resume(scopeKey string, index int) (string, error)
|
||||||
|
Prune(scopeKey string, limit int) ([]string, error)
|
||||||
|
}
|
||||||
|
|
||||||
|
type Runtime interface {
|
||||||
|
Channel() string
|
||||||
|
ScopeKey() string
|
||||||
|
SessionOps() SessionOps
|
||||||
|
Config() *config.Config
|
||||||
|
}
|
||||||
|
```
|
||||||
|
|
||||||
|
**Step 4: Run test to verify it passes**
|
||||||
|
|
||||||
|
Run: `go test ./pkg/commands -run TestRuntimeContracts_MinimalSessionOps -v`
|
||||||
|
Expected: PASS.
|
||||||
|
|
||||||
|
**Step 5: Commit**
|
||||||
|
|
||||||
|
```bash
|
||||||
|
git add pkg/commands/runtime.go pkg/commands/runtime_test.go
|
||||||
|
git commit -m "refactor(commands): add runtime interfaces for agent-backed handlers"
|
||||||
|
```
